Abstract EN
The second order non-polynomial spline function for solving system of two nonlinear Volterra integral equations is proposed in this paper.
An algorithm introduced as well to numerical examples to illustrate carry out of this method.
Also, we compare the absolute error of quadratic non-polynomial spline method with absolute error of linear non-polynomial spline method and the exact solution.
